Directions

  1. 1
    TO PREPARE CAKE:.
  2. 2
    Preheat oven to 350°F.
  3. 3
    Combine flour and next 6 ingredients(through salt) in a large bowl.
  4. 4
    Add mayonnaise and oil beat with a mixer at low speed until well blended.
  5. 5
    Slowly add brewed coffee and vanilla, beat with a mixer at low speed 1 minute or until well blended.
  6. 6
    Stir in chocolate; pour batter into 9x13" baking dish coated with cooking spray.
  7. 7
    Bake for 30 minutes or until wooden pick inserted in center comes out clean.
  8. 8
    Cool completely in pan on wire rack.
  9. 9
    TO PREPARE MOCHA CREAM:.
  10. 10
    Combine water and granules in a large bowl stir until granules dissolve.
  11. 11
    Add marshmallow creme; beat with a mixer at low speed until smooth.
  12. 12
    Fold in whipped topping.
  13. 13
    Spread mocha cream over top of cake; drizzle with chocolate syrup and sprinkle with nuts.
